Cleaning Tip: The Direct Steam Nozzle creates direct steam spray to clean and 
sanitise hard to reach nooks & crannies and other places where germs may build 
up. Use the Direct Steam Nozzle to loosen and dislodge compact dirt often 
found in corner and tight places where traditional methods and cleaning tools 
tend to push dirt into, making it tough to reach and clean. Spray direct steam 
and wipe clean with a wet cloth or paper towel.

   FOR SPOT CLEANING AND STEAMING 
2   First attach the Direct Steam Nozzle by pressing 
the nozzle onto the Handheld Steamer until it 
clicks into place. (fig. 16)
3   The Handheld Steamer is automatically set to 
SCRUB mode. Squeeze the steam trigger to 
activate steam. To change modes press the ON/
STEAM SETTING button to select either DUST, 
MOP or SCRUB mode. You can change the steam 
mode while the Handheld Steamer is in standby 
or in use. Once the selected setting indicator 
light has turned blue, hold down the steam 
trigger to start steaming. (fig. 17)
   For effective cleaning, hold the steam output 
nozzle 1-2 inches away from the surface you’re 
cleaning.
